Latest Patents

Hofer's latest patents include a high-fidelity model-driven deception platform for cyber-physical systems. This invention describes methods for safeguarding a cyber-physical system against potential attackers. The methods involve generating a training data set and training a system model to create a decoy that mimics historical outputs of the system. Additionally, the patent outlines a process for receiving system context and inquiries from potential attackers, applying a system model to generate synthetic outputs that simulate the system's responses.

Another patent by Hofer also pertains to a high-fidelity model-driven deception platform. This system is designed to protect cyber-physical systems by collecting historical information and training a machine-learned model to predict future conditions. Upon detecting an input signal, the system can alert the cyber-physical system of a potential attacker and simulate the system's functionality based on predicted future conditions.
